Output 34676954ab436ad223073ef6e70b21bdf6489284859cfa0e874cdc4d8ebb4c0b:9

value
57767287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33e566240a1c60d3317e280ab7007d87d18fb1f5 OP_EQUAL
address
MCdZW8m6LVx6SGoU5cSFW86Pv9Z4vbVPqT
transaction
34676954ab436ad223073ef6e70b21bdf6489284859cfa0e874cdc4d8ebb4c0b
spent
true